Understanding the Enemy: Common Tile Stains

Bathroom tiles are subject to various stains, from soap scum to mildew. Understanding these culprits is the first step in tackling them effectively. Soap scum, a filmy residue that builds up when soap combines with water minerals, can dull your tiles. Mildew, a type of fungus, thrives in moist environments and appears as black or white patches, especially in grout lines. Hard water stains, caused by mineral deposits, leave unsightly marks on tiles. Recognizing these issues helps choose the right cleaning approach.

Mildew and soap scum may seem harmless but can lead to more significant problems if left untreated. Soap scum can etch into the tiles, making them prone to further staining. Mildew not only looks unpleasant but can also produce a musty odor and pose health risks, especially for those with allergies. Hard water stains, though primarily aesthetic, can contribute to the wear and tear of tiles over time. Regular maintenance is key to preventing these issues from becoming overwhelming.

Assessing the type of tile is crucial, as different materials react differently to cleaning agents. Ceramic and porcelain tiles are more forgiving and can withstand robust cleaning, whereas natural stone tiles like marble and granite require gentler care to avoid damage. Tailoring your cleaning strategy to the material helps maintain the integrity and appearance of your tiles.

Weekly Deep Clean for Lasting Shine

While daily maintenance is essential, a weekly deep clean ensures that your bathroom tiles remain in top condition. This step involves using more targeted cleaning solutions to tackle stubborn stains and kill any lingering bacteria.

Begin by choosing a suitable cleaner for your tile type. For ceramic and porcelain tiles, an all-purpose bathroom cleaner or a homemade solution of vinegar and water works well. For natural stone tiles, opt for a pH-balanced stone cleaner to avoid damaging the surface. Apply the cleaner generously, and allow it to sit for a few minutes to loosen dirt and grime.

Scrubbing is a crucial part of the deep cleaning process. Use a soft-bristle brush or toothbrush to scrub the tiles, focusing on grout lines where dirt tends to accumulate. A circular motion ensures even cleaning and helps lift stains without scratching the tiles. Rinse thoroughly with water afterward to remove any cleaner residue, leaving your tiles sparkling clean.


Effective Homemade Cleaners

Store-bought cleaners are convenient but can be expensive and contain harsh chemicals. Fortunately, homemade solutions offer an eco-friendly and cost-effective alternative that can be just as effective.

A popular homemade cleaner involves mixing equal parts white vinegar and water in a spray bottle. Vinegar's acidity helps dissolve soap scum and mineral deposits, while water dilutes it to a safe concentration for most tiles. Spray the solution onto the tiles, wait a few minutes, and wipe down with a microfiber cloth for a streak-free finish.

For tougher stains, baking soda comes to the rescue. Make a paste by combining baking soda with water, and apply it to the stained areas. Baking soda's gentle abrasiveness helps scrub away grime without damaging the tiles. Allow the paste to sit for 10 minutes before scrubbing with a brush and rinsing thoroughly.

Essential oils can enhance the cleaning experience by adding pleasant scents and additional antibacterial properties. A few drops of lemon or tea tree oil in your cleaning solution can leave your bathroom smelling fresh and add an extra layer of cleanliness.


Mastering Grout Maintenance

Grout, the filler between tiles, often requires special attention as it can quickly become discolored and stained. Regular maintenance extends the life of grout and enhances the overall appearance of your tiles.

Start by inspecting the grout lines for any visible dirt or mold. A simple cleaning solution of baking soda and water can be used to scrub grout lines with a toothbrush. The paste should be applied, left for a few minutes, and then scrubbed away to remove stains.

For more stubborn grout stains, hydrogen peroxide offers a powerful cleaning boost. Mix it with baking soda to form a paste and apply it to the affected areas. The fizzing action helps lift stains and kill germs, leaving your grout looking fresh and clean. Always rinse thoroughly to remove any residue.

Sealing grout is a preventive measure that protects against stains and moisture penetration. Apply a grout sealer every six months to a year, depending on the traffic in your bathroom. This step creates a barrier that repels dirt and water, keeping grout looking new for longer.


Preventing Future Stains

Prevention is always better than cure. Implementing habits that reduce the chance of stains forming is crucial for maintaining clean bathroom tiles. Start by reducing moisture levels in your bathroom, as damp environments encourage the growth of mold and mildew.

Install a good-quality bathroom fan or dehumidifier to control humidity levels. Run the fan during and after showers to help remove excess moisture from the air. Additionally, leaving the bathroom door open after use promotes airflow, drying out surfaces more quickly.

Rug placement also aids in keeping tiles clean. Use absorbent bath mats outside the shower to catch water drips, and wash them regularly to prevent mold growth. This simple step minimizes the amount of water that reaches your tiles, reducing the likelihood of stains.

Maintenance for Different Tile Types

Different tiles have different cleaning needs. Understanding these requirements ensures you choose the right methods and products for each tile type.

Ceramic and porcelain tiles are resilient and can withstand robust cleaning. Use vinegar and water solutions for regular maintenance, and scrub with baking soda for deeper cleans.

Natural stone tiles require a gentler approach. Avoid acidic cleaners like vinegar, which can etch the surface. Instead, use pH-balanced stone cleaners to preserve the stone's natural beauty.

Glass tiles are best cleaned with non-abrasive products. A vinegar and water solution works well, but be sure to rinse thoroughly to avoid streaks.

Tiles are prized for their durability, beauty, and easy upkeep—but keeping them shining like new doesn’t have to mean using harsh chemicals. With the right natural cleaning techniques, you can maintain spotless, glossy tiles that stand the test of time. At Champs Tile Installation Austin, we know that the secret to long-lasting tile shine starts with everyday care and eco-friendly methods. Here are our favorite natural cleaning hacks that help Austin homeowners keep their tile surfaces looking flawless year-round. 1. Start with the Basics: Baking Soda and Vinegar Baking soda and vinegar make a powerful natural cleaning duo. How to use: Sprinkle baking soda directly over your tile surfaces and grout lines. Then spray with equal parts water and white vinegar. Let the mixture fizz for a few minutes before scrubbing gently with a soft brush or cloth. Why it works: The bubbling action loosens dirt and grime while the baking soda polishes the surface without scratching it. Pro Tip from Champs Tile Installation Austin: Always rinse with warm water and buff dry to bring out that lasting, natural shine. 2. Add Some Sparkle with Lemon Juice Lemon juice is a natural degreaser that brightens dull tiles and leaves behind a clean, citrus scent. How to use: Mix the juice of one lemon with a cup of warm water. Wipe it over tiles using a microfiber cloth, then dry to prevent streaks. Bonus: The natural acidity in lemon juice helps remove soap scum and water spots, making it ideal for bathroom tiles and kitchen backsplashes. 3. Everyday Maintenance Spray with Essential Oils Keep your tiles fresh between cleanings with this all-natural spray: Combine 1 cup distilled water, 1 cup white vinegar, and 10 drops of essential oil (like lavender, tea tree, or eucalyptus). Spray lightly over tiles and wipe dry with a clean cloth. This simple solution cleans, deodorizes, and adds a gentle shine without leaving chemical residue—perfect for families who prefer green cleaning. 4. Prevent Dullness with Regular Care To maintain your tile’s brilliance: Sweep or vacuum often to remove abrasive dirt. Wipe spills immediately to avoid stains. Skip harsh cleaners that can wear away the tile’s finish over time. At Champs Tile Installation Austin, we recommend using soft microfiber mops or cloths to protect the surface and keep tiles looking freshly installed. 5. Refresh the Grout Naturally Even when your tiles sparkle, dirty grout can dull the overall look. DIY grout cleaner: Mix baking soda with hydrogen peroxide to form a paste. Apply it to grout lines, let sit for 10–15 minutes, then scrub gently with a toothbrush. Rinse well and dry to reveal brighter grout and cleaner tile surfaces. 6. Deep Clean with Steam For a completely chemical-free deep clean, consider using a steam cleaner. The high-temperature steam lifts dirt and kills bacteria naturally—ideal for Austin homes where humidity and moisture can lead to buildup in bathrooms and kitchens. When it comes to creating a beautiful, long-lasting tile floor, the secret isn’t just in the tile itself — it’s in the foundation beneath it. A properly prepared subfloor ensures your tiles stay level, secure, and free from cracks for years to come. At Champs Tile Installation Austin , we know that the key to flawless floors starts well before the first tile is laid. Here’s how to get your subfloor ready for a professional-grade tile installation. 1. Assess Your Subfloor Material Before you begin, identify what type of subfloor you’re working with. Most homes in Austin have either concrete or wood subfloors, and each requires different preparation steps: Concrete subfloors should be smooth, clean, and free from moisture issues. Wood subfloors need to be sturdy, properly fastened, and covered with an approved tile underlayment such as cement board or a decoupling membrane. Understanding your base helps ensure proper adhesion and prevents future movement that can crack your tiles. 2. Check for Structural Integrity Even the most beautiful tile can’t fix a weak or uneven floor. Walk across the subfloor and listen for creaks or soft spots — these indicate loose boards or structural problems that must be repaired before installation. If you’re working with wood, secure loose planks with screws. For concrete, patch any cracks or divots using a leveling compound. At Champs Tile Installation Austin , we always recommend addressing these issues early to guarantee a stable and durable surface for your tile. 3. Ensure a Level Surface Uneven subfloors are a common cause of cracked or misaligned tiles. Use a long level or straight edge to check for dips or humps across the floor. Even minor unevenness can cause problems once the tiles are set. For concrete , use a self-leveling compound to smooth out imperfections. For wood , add or sand down underlayment as needed to achieve a level surface. Remember: the smoother the foundation, the cleaner and more professional your tile layout will look. 4. Clean Thoroughly Before Installation Dust, oil, paint, and debris can all interfere with tile adhesion. Sweep and vacuum the entire area, then wipe down the surface with a damp mop to remove fine dust. If you’re working with concrete, check for moisture by taping a plastic sheet to the floor for 24 hours — condensation indicates that you’ll need to address moisture control before tiling. Cleanliness might seem simple, but it’s one of the most important steps in subfloor preparation. 5. Install the Right Underlayment Underlayment creates a smooth, stable base between your subfloor and tile while adding an extra layer of protection against movement and moisture. Common underlayment options include: Cement backer board – Great for durability and moisture resistance. Decoupling membranes – Ideal for preventing cracks caused by subfloor movement. Foam underlayments – Useful in soundproofing and minor leveling. Your choice depends on your subfloor type and the area of installation — for instance, bathrooms and kitchens need extra moisture protection. 6. Prime for Adhesion (If Needed) Some subfloors, particularly smooth concrete or specialized underlayments, benefit from a primer before applying thin-set mortar. A primer enhances bonding, reduces dust, and ensures a stronger hold between the subfloor and tile. 7.
